Key Features
Carbon CC Frame– Santa Cruz´s highest grade CC-level carbon frame is every bit as stiff and strong as their C-level frame, but weighs about 280 grams less, due to the use of lighter, stronger, and more expensive carbon fiber. Santa Cruz is also able to truly integrate the shock mounts, pivot mounts, dropouts and disc brake tabs into the structure, using all uni-directional carbon plies. The shock mount isn´t merely riveted or bonded on after curing, but is an integrated part of the fiber lay-up. This makes Santa Cruz´s carbon frames incredibly strong and able to absorb impact better than any other frame they´ve tested.

Lower-Link Mounted VPP® Suspension– VPP is based on the patented principle of having two short links rotating in opposite directions. This system provides huge design flexibility, allowing Santa Cruz to manipulate shock rates to the intended purpose and character of each model; from short travel endurance bikes to World Championship winning DH machines. This redesign mounts the shock lower on the bike, making for an even better ride quality.

SRAM X01 Eagle, 12-SpeedIt might look normal from the outside, but the engineering inside this incredible chain design makes possible a gear range previously found only in 2-chainring drivetrains. And it´s also the biggest contributor to the Eagle drivetrain´s ultra-smooth, precise, durable and quiet performance. The Eagle chain´s links have a smooth radius, with no sharp edges or chamfers, which yield a significant reduction in noise, friction and wear on chainrings and cassette cogs. This design also allows for a flatter plate, which means more consistent chain riveting and greater overall strength. Hard Chrome technology extends the chain´s optimal performance life.

- Rear Tire: Maxxis Minion DHR II 2.4" | 3C MaxxTerra, DoubleDown More
Rear Tire
Maxxis Minion DHR II 2.4" | 3C MaxxTerra, DoubleDownWith side knobs borrowed from the legendary Minion DHF, but widened to provide more support, the DHR II corners like no other. The center tread features ramped leading edges to improve acceleration and sipes to create a smooth transition when leaning the bike. Paddle-like knobs on the center tread dig in under hard braking and help keep the bike under control.- 3C MaxxTerra: A triple compound ideal for trail riding in all conditions - offers more traction than 3C MaxxSpeed, yet provides better treadwear and less rolling resistance than 3C MaxxGrip.
- DoubleDown (DD): Two layers of lightweight 120 TPI casing combined with a butyl sidewall insert creates a highly durable tire with more trail feedback than a Downhill casing tire.
